Redefining the Boundaries: Dietmar Hamann Slams Antonio Rüdiger After Outburst in Spanish Cup Final

Ex-German national footballer Dietmar Hamann has strongly criticized Antonio Rüdiger following his outburst in the Spanish Cup final on Saturday, which culminated in his being sent off. In the Sport1 program "Doppelpass", Hamann urged that Rüdiger should not be selected for the upcoming UEFA Nations League semi-final: "His actions were incompatible with the values and responsibility emphasized by our current coach, Julian Nagelsmann."

A Penalty for Passion?

The controversial confrontation occurred in the Copa del Rey final between Real Madrid and Barcelona, where Rüdiger, after being substituted, threw an ice pack towards the referee and launched insults in German. The defender was shown a red card for his actions.

Scrutiny and Apologies

Subsequent to the incident, Rüdiger issued a public apology, admitting that his behavior was inappropriate. Media outlets widely condemned his actions, highlighting the unprofessionalism and possible consequences for his club and country.

The Final Whistle and Beyond

Rüdiger has been given a six-match ban for his actions by the Spanish Football Federation (RFEF). However, the ban only impacts Spanish domestic competitions, such as La Liga and Copa del Rey. UEFA regulations regarding international suspensions are distinct from those of national federations. As such, Rüdiger's recent knee surgery and recovery timeline are more likely to affect his availability for upcoming international matches, rather than the ban itself.

Germany faces Portugal in the Nations League on Wednesday, June 4, 2025, at 20:45 CET in Munich. The nations eagerly await the team's response and the fallout from Rüdiger's actions in the Spanish Cup final.
